Navigating the intricate of ad network pricing structures can be a daunting task for advertisers. However, by deciphering the basic concepts, you can effectively optimize your advertising budget and enhance your return on campaign.

Ad networks typically employ various pricing models, such as pay-per-click (PPC), cost per view, and cost-per-acquisition (CPA). Each model varies in terms of how advertisers are charged.

Consider, CPC pricing revolves around paying a fee for every click on your advertisement. On the other hand, CPM pricing charges advertisers based on the number of views their ads receive.

Understanding these different pricing structures is crucial for formulating a effective advertising strategy.

By carefully evaluating your campaign targets and grasping the nuances of each pricing model, you can make informed decisions that match with your budget and maximize your advertising ROI.
